Gartner, a leading IT research firm, has projected annual revenue and earnings below Wall Street expectations due to a decline in enterprise spending. This reduced investment is expected to negatively impact demand for Gartner's consulting services, potentially affecting its stock performance and influencing broader IT market sentiment.
